Reversible Decorating For Your Kitchen

When you think of decorating a kitchen, you probably picture expensive cabinets or counter tops but making a big change doesn t have to include a major overhaul. One simple and inexpensive way to change the look in your kitchen is to change or add to what you have on the kitchen walls. Making changes this way gives you great flexibility as if you don t like what you see you can always move it around or reverse the look all together.
What is the first thing you notice when you walk into someone s home? The walls, right? Walls enclose the home, giving a thematic impression. So, if your walls are empty you ve got to get to work to populate them. Wall hangings can be expensive, but that s only if you purchase something by a famous dead artist. You can create your own artwork without any art instruction whatsoever. First, you have to consider your theme. If you have a country kitchen theme then you will want country style artwork. A modern kitchen theme will look best with prints in sleek frames. A retro look? Then get some vintage style prints of old signs or baking products.
Do you have hundreds of pictures and just don t know what to do with them? If the idea of a personalized kitchen picture wall appeals to you, you could arrange the photos into a huge wall photo collage. Examples include pictures of exotic places, weddings, and children growing up. Although you will have more fun creating your collage yourself, there are companies that will take care of this for you. The cost ranges from about $50 for an 8×10 to $150 for a 20×24 wall collage.
If your kitchen has an outdoorsy, caf or nature feel, you might want to consider pressing leaves or flowers and framing your work the best of these are flat. You basically place the leaves or flowers in a book to allow them to dry flat. They are ready for your wall hanging when they become crisp. This shouldn t take longer than a week or two. After the items are pressed, you will just need to mount the artwork and hang it on your wall.
When you decorate your kitchen with artwork you are only limited by your imagination. Don t be afraid to experiment. As mentioned previously, artwork is easily reversible. So, be imaginative and creative and design your artwork.
